Árvore de páginas

Versões comparadas

Chave

  • Esta linha foi adicionada.
  • Esta linha foi removida.
  • A formatação mudou.

Esta função pode ser utilizada para adequar o caminho da imagem, para que busque as imagens do novo facelift 2023.


Informações
titleCONCEITO

A busca da imagem de toolbar deve seguir algumas regras após o facelift. Primeiramente buscar na pasta 2023 caso não exista, procurar na pasta toolbarPara adequar as imagens do Datasul ao novo facelift 2023, com novas cores e formato minimalista, foi criada a pasta 2023 na estrutura "FOUNDATION\progress\src\image\2023" com o subdiretório toolbar com as novas imagens aderentes ao facelift. Mesmo que a pasta não esteja no propath, o facelift vai procurar primeiramente essa pasta e, caso a imagem não exista, vai procurar na pasta toolbar. Por fim, caso também não exista, utilizar vai procurar a imagem da na pasta raiz, image

As imagens iniciais são substituídas automaticamente antes da abertura do programa, as imagens carregadas em tempo de execução devem utilizar a função pi_procura_caminho_image para que carregue a imagem mais atualizada, respeitando a regra acima.

Sintaxe

...

Bloco de código
RUN pi_procura_caminho_image IN h_handle (INPUT 'nome_imagem', OUTPUT imagem_habilitada, OUTPUT imagem_desabilitada).


Parâmetros


Nome

Tipo

Obrigatório?

Descrição

nome_imagem
CHARSim

Imagem a ser buscada.

Retorno

...

Tipo

Descrição

CHAR

Caminho da imagem habilitada.

CHARCaminho da imagem desabilitada.

Exemplo

...

Informações
iconfalse

Exemplo :

Bloco de código
languageruby
themeConfluence
linenumberstrue
DEFINE VARIABLE cValSensi AS CHARACTER   NO-UNDO.
DEFINE VARIABLE cValInsensi AS CHARACTER   NO-UNDO.

RUN pi_procura_caminho_image IN h_facelift (INPUT 'image/im-notai', OUTPUT cValSensi, OUTPUT cValInsensi).
bt_des_anot_tab1:load-image-up(cValSensi)

...